Specialist Diploma in Hospitality Management

Overview

The Specialist Diploma in Hospitality Management (SDHM) course allows students to acquire knowledge in key subject areas that will prepare them to take advantage of the diverse opportunities in the rapidly growing sectors of tourism, hospitality and related businesses. It will also provide students with the knowledge and understanding of the various activities within the tourism and hospitality industries. Students will study and develop skills related to front office operations, restaurant management, facilities management including housekeeping, customer service and communications in the English language.

Modules Covered

Fundamentals of Front Office Operations

Basic Restaurant Operations

Hospitality Facilities Management

Tourism & Hospitality English

Service Quality

Industrial Attachment*

Industrial Attachment*

*The Industrial Attachment (if any) is an integral module of the programme. However, suppose a student is unable to participate in the Industrial Attachment module due to circumstances beyond the control of the Student or the College, like non-approval of the Training Work Permit by the Ministry of Manpower or unable to secure an intern placement due to unavailability of vacancies, the Student will be required to complete a Research-Based Project with the submission of a report to be considered for graduation for the course. While AAC will make its best efforts to secure Industrial Attachment for the students, it does not guarantee that it will be able to secure one for every student.

Graduation Requirement:
In order to be awarded the Specialist Diploma in Hospitality Management, a student must obtain at least a Pass Grade in all the modules within the eligibility period of 2 years from the original completion date.

Certificate will be awarded by Academies Australasia College.
